Plesk is a powerful control panel for managing web hosting processes. However, like any system, you may encounter critical errors from time to time. In this article, we will detail the steps to diagnose and resolve common issues you may face on Plesk.
1. Diagnosing the Issue
When you suspect that there is an issue with your server, the first step is to identify the root of the problem. Below are some common commands:
top: Displays the current process status on the server.
htop: Shows the process status with a more user-friendly interface. (You may need to install it first with sudo apt install htop.)
dmesg: Used to view kernel and system errors. You can use dmesg | less to view the output page by page.
tail -f /var/log/syslog: Used to monitor server logs in real-time.
2. Common Issues and Solutions
2.1. Apache Error
If you notice that your Apache server is not running, you can follow these steps:
First, check the status of Apache:
sudo systemctl status apache2
If the server is stopped, restart it:
sudo systemctl restart apache2
2.2. MySQL Error
If you suspect that the MySQL database server is not running:
Check the status:
sudo systemctl status mysql
If it is stopped, restart it:
sudo systemctl restart mysql
2.3. Plesk Panel Error
If you are experiencing issues with the Plesk control panel:
Check the status of the panel:
sudo plesk status
If any issues are detected, restart the panel:
sudo plesk restart
3. Performance Optimization
You can perform some optimizations to enhance your server's performance:
Optimize connection settings in the httpd.conf file for Apache:
Managing a server with Plesk can be done seamlessly when the right steps are followed. The steps above will help you diagnose and resolve common errors. If you encounter any issues, don't forget to check the system logs and necessary services.